
Historical fire pits were sometimes constructed from the floor, within caves, or at the middle of a hut or home. Evidence of prehistoric, man-made fires exists on all five inhabited continents. The drawback of early indoor flame pits was that they generated toxic and/or annoying smoke within the dwelling.Fire pits developed into raised hearths in structures, but ventilation smoke depended on open windows or holes in roofs. The great hall typically needed a centrally located hearth, where a open flame burned with the smoke rising to the vent in the roof. Louvers were developed during the Middle Ages to allow the roof vents to be coated so rain and snow would not enter.
Also throughout the Middle Ages, smoke canopies were devised to stop smoke from spreading through a room and vent it outside through a wall or roof. These can be placed against rock walls, rather than taking up the middle of the room, and this enabled smaller rooms to be warmed.Chimneys were invented in northern Europe in the 11th or 12th centuries and largely fixed the problem of fumes, more reliably venting smoke out. They made it feasible to provide the fireplace a draft, and made it possible to put fireplaces in numerous rooms in buildings conveniently. They did not come into general use immediately, however, as they were more expensive to build and maintain.In 1678 Prince Rupert, nephew of Charles I, raised the grate of the fireplace, improving the airflow and venting system. The 18th century saw two important developments in the history of fireplaces. Benjamin Franklin developed a convection room for the fireplace which greatly improved the efficacy of fireplaces and wood stoves. He also enhanced the airflow by pulling air from a cellar and venting out a lengthier place on very top. In the later 18th century, Count Rumford made a fireplace with a tall, shallow firebox which was better at drawing up the smoke and from the building. The shallow design also improved greatly the quantity of radiant heat projected to the room. Rumford's design is the foundation for modern kitchens.

On the exterior there is often a corbeled brick crown, where the casting courses of brick act as a drip route to keep rainwater from running down the exterior walls. A hood, cap, or shroud serves to keep rainwater from the outside of the chimney; rain in the chimney is a far greater problem in chimneys lined with impervious flue tiles or metal liners than with the standard masonry chimney, which divides up all but the rain. Some chimneys have a spark arrestor integrated into the crown or cap.

Masonry and prefabricated fireplaces can be fueled by wood, natural gas, biomass and gas fuel sources. In the USA, several states and local counties have laws limiting these kinds of fireplaces. They must be properly sized to the area to be heated. Additionally, there are air quality control problems due to the quantity of moisture that they discharge into the room atmosphere, and oxygen detector and carbon dioxide sensors are safety essentials. Direct vent fireplaces are fueled by either liquid propane or natural gas. They are completely sealed from the place that is heated, and vent all exhaust gasses to the exterior of the structure.

Over time, the purpose of fireplaces has transformed from one of requirement to one of interest. Early ones were more fire pits compared to modern fireplaces. They have been used for warmth on chilly days and nights, in addition to for cooking. They also served as a gathering place inside the house. These fire pits were generally centered within a room, allowing more individuals to collect around it.

Some fireplace units incorporate a blower that transfers more of the fireplace's heat to the atmosphere via convection, resulting in a more evenly heated space and a decrease heating load. Fireplace efficiency can also be enhanced by means of a fireback, a piece of metal which sits behind the fire and reflects heat back into the room. Firebacks are traditionally made from cast iron, but can also be made from stainless steel. Efficiency is a complex notion though with open hearth fireplaces. Most efficiency tests consider only the effect of heating of the air. An open fireplace is not, and never was, intended to heat the air. A fireplace with a fireback is a toaster, and has done so since the 15th century. The ideal way to gauge the output of a fireplace is if you notice you are turning the thermostat down or up.
Most older fireplaces have a relatively low efficiency rating. Standard, contemporary, weatherproof masonry fireplaces though have an efficiency rating of 80% (legal minimum requirement such as in Salzburg/Austria). To boost efficiency, fireplaces can also be modified by adding special heavy fireboxes designed to burn much cleaner and may reach efficiencies as high as 80 percent in heating the atmosphere. These altered fireplaces are usually equipped with a massive fire window, allowing an efficient heating system in two stages. During the first stage the initial heat is provided through a large glass window while the flame is burning. During this time period the construction, constructed of refractory bricks, absorbs the warmth. This warmth is then evenly radiated for several hours during the next stage. Masonry fireplaces with no glass fire window only provide heat radiated from the surface.
